Output fec77053342ee314c2e782c4268a3cb8768c9c6a21af551a4f9d6f267a635df9:55
- value
- 595094
- script pubkey
- OP_0 OP_PUSHBYTES_20 e20e7d638a0d31284992018ae3935b38867f1d6c
- address
- bc1qug886cu2p5cjsjvjqx9w8y6m8zr878tvpeqne3
- transaction
- fec77053342ee314c2e782c4268a3cb8768c9c6a21af551a4f9d6f267a635df9
- spent
- true